The childhood of Patricia Lockwood, the poet dubbed’ The Smutty-Metaphor Queen of Lawrence, Kansas’ by The New York Times,was unusual in many respects. There was the location: an impoverished,nuclear waste-riddled area of the American Midwest. There was hermother, a woman who speaks almost entirely in strange riddles andwarnings of impending danger. Above all, there was her gun-toting,guitar-riffing, frequently semi-naked father, who underwent a religiousconversion on a submarine and found a loophole which saw him approvedfor the Catholic priesthood by the future Pope Benedict XVI, despitealready having a wife and children.
When an unexpected crisisforces Lockwood and her husband to move back into her parents’ rectory,she must learn to live again with the family’s simmering madness, and toreckon with the dark side of her religious upbringing. Pivoting fromthe raunchy to the sublime, from the comic to the serious, Priestdaddyis an unforgettable story of how we balance tradition against hard-wonidentity – and of how, having journeyed in the underworld, we can emergewith our levity and our sense of justice intact.
